Experience Iceland’s icy wilderness on this small-group, beginner-friendly glacier hike on Sólheimajökull. Feel the ice crunch under your crampons and discover hidden ice formations and deep blue crevasses that are impossible to see from a distance. Your professional, friendly guide ensures a safe, supportive experience, providing all necessary glacier gear and clear instruction every step of the way. No prior experience is needed, making this an ideal adventure for families, couples, and solo travelers alike. With multiple daily departures, this tour fits easily into any South Coast itinerary. Step onto the glacier curious, and leave with unforgettable memories and a deeper connection to Iceland’s ever-changing glacial world.
Suitable for all physical fitness levels
Minimum age of 8, and minimum shoe size of EUR 35
Sturdy hiking boots with ankle support are mandatory (available to rent for a fee if needed)
The tour is rated as easy - no prior experience is needed but guests should expect to walk ~3km over uneven terrain
Please note that our specialized glacier crampons are only available for shoe sizes 35-50 EU. Those with a shoe size beyond these are unfortunately unable to participate.

Join us for an unforgettable glacier hike on Sólheimajökull, meaning ''Home of the Sun Glacier'', one of Iceland's famous natural wonders. Located on Iceland’s iconic South Coast, this adventure is for anyone who wants to touch real ice and see the wonders of a glacier firsthand. It is a perfect blend of easy exercise and breathtaking scenery. Your adventure begins at our base in the Sólheimajökull Parking Lot, about a 35-minute drive from the town of Vík. Here, you meet your friendly, certified glacier guide. After a safety briefing and gear-up, you’ll embark on a scenic walk toward the ice, passing a glacier lagoon where blue icebergs float beautifully in the water. Once we step onto the ice, you’ll discover a frozen world of towering ridges and deep blue formations. Our friendly local experts will be right beside you to ensure you feel safe and confident, while they bring the glacier to life with stories of the glacier - how it was formed, how it is changing, and why it is so special to Iceland. We keep our groups small for a more personal experience with plenty of time for questions, making this a top choice for families, couples, and solo travellers.
